Sweden Fat Tire Bike Criterium
The Sweden Fat Tire Bike Criterium will take place on the trails in Sweden Town Park in Brockport, NY. The course will consist of wooded trails sections, double track, bridges, and open fields. The course is relatively flat, but the trails sections have plenty of rocks and roots to keep things fun. 9am: 2 hour fat tire bike race, $40 registration. 11:30am: 1 hour open race, $30 registration.
